IGNACIO GARCÍA ERGÜIN (Bilbao, 1934).
"Ondárroa", 1974.
Oil on canvas.
Signed in the lower right corner. Signed, dated and titled on the back.
Measurements: 60 x 73 cm; 81 x 4 cm (frame).
Ergüin was born in Bilbao, having his first contact with painting at the age of 14 when he made several watercolors of great technical quality. In 1946 he began his studies at the Diocesan Seminary and in 1951 he left the ecclesiastical career to begin his painting and drawing studies at the trade union school, with professors José Lorenzo Solís and Salinas. In 1958 he set up his first studio on María de Muñoz Street in the city of Bilbao and began a series of trips that took him to Paris, where he painted his first landscapes from life. In November 1958 he received the First National Painting Prize for Education and Rest in Madrid. That same year, he continued to travel around Castile, thus making his first contact with the city of Toledo, always very present in the artist's professional career. Throughout his career he has received numerous awards such as the bronze medal at the XVII National Exhibition of Education and Rest in Malaga in 1959, First Prize Rodriguez Acosta Foundation of Granada in 1964, Diputación de León Prize in the first National Fine Arts in 1964, Second Medal and Quintería Prize in the XVI National of Valdepeñas in 1965, Third Medal in the National of Fine Arts in 1966, First Prize of painting to the best painting that represented Bermeo in 1968, First Medal of Drawing and Second Medal of Painting in the First National Biennial of Sport in Art in 1970, among other awards.
